The purpose of the role
The Marketing Coordinator, National Theatre at Home (NTAH) is responsible for coordinating and supporting the delivery of  marketing campaigns that help deliver the NTAH marketing strategy to grow the brand and effectively acquire, activate and retain subscriptions to meet business goals.
National Theatre at Home is a direct-to-consumer (SVOD) streaming service that brings the best of British theatre to audiences across the globe, streaming iconic National Theatre productions straight from the theatre’s stages as well as partner theatres across the UK. A leader in its field, NTAH is at an exciting point in its growth journey and we are looking for a dynamic Marketing Coordinator to join the growing team.
The Marketing Coordinator reports to the Head of National Theatre at Home and will work closely with the CRM, Social, Programming, Data Studio and in-house creative teams to support the delivery of brand and show release campaigns, as well as support across performance marketing colleagues, developing new and innovative ways to bring streamed theatre to new and engaged audiences.
